Why would you want too do that? You lay out approx 2k for the server, add to that data center costs, tech support, routers and a ton of other overhead. Now at best you make 1-2 bucks per meg, so MAYBE (but most likely not) you will break even in 3 years?..........Just doesnt make sense. You cannot run a profitable business of any kind when you sell your product at a loss or a 3 year breakeven point.:2 cents: |
